fix(emacs): assess if there are open frames of the expected type
...
This change looks at the frame type of the open frames ('framep) and
looks if they're of the type requested based on the arguments passed
to emacsclient (-nw/-t/--tty require tty frames, otherwise we need
graphical frames).
NOTE: this code considers anything different than t as graphical
terminals, including MS-DOS types (pc). I don't have such a setup
to test if this is correct.

08da19e3fd
emacs: revert cab1ac6e68
( #7765 )
...
Revert cab1ac6e68
The change from the above commit breaks opening a new emacs frame if
there isn't a existing frame open.
When emacs is running in daemon mode, there will always be a frame
associated with the daemon, even if there are no visible frames.
The lisp function `frame-list`, will always return 1 frame.
```
emacsclient --eval '(frame-list)'
(#<frame F1 0xa3c680>)
```
When an real frame is open, two frames are reported by the `frame-list`
function.
```
emacsclient --eval '(frame-list)'
(#<frame F1 0xa3c680> #<frame emacs Prelude - ~/oh-my-zsh/plugins/emacs/emacsclient.sh 0xf50e10>)
```
